3. What Audifact is — and is not
Audifact is an append-only, hash-chained event ledger for AI agent decisions and outcomes. You can record events via our API and SDKs, verify integrity independently (Explorer, verify API, snapshots), and share proof links for individual events.
We are not an insurance provider, warranty of agent performance, compliance certification, legal advisor, or substitute for your own security, governance, or regulatory programs. Verification tools are designed to help detect tampering with recorded chain data; they do not guarantee that your systems cannot be compromised or misused.

7. Immutable ledger and account closure
The Service is built as an immutable audit ledger. Events appended to the chain are not deleted as part of normal operation, because removal would break tamper-evident verification.
To close an account, email support@audifact.io. We will disable login and API access, cancel active subscriptions where applicable, and anonymize or delete account-identifying information (such as your name and email) where feasible.
Hash-chained event records and customer-submitted event content may remain retained after closure for integrity, fraud prevention, and legal compliance. See our Privacy Policy for details.
